Goldman Sachs sees financials earnings risks as oil prices climb
bearishApr 7, 2026 · 06:05 PM

Goldman Sachs sees financials earnings risks as oil prices climb

Goldman Sachs has raised concerns regarding the earnings outlook for financial sector companies due to rising oil prices. The increase in oil prices is likely to lead to higher borrowing costs and could potentially impact the default rates on loans, which may affect banks' profitability. Analysts suggest that if oil prices continue to rise, financial institutions heavily exposed to commodity markets may face significant headwinds. Additionally, higher energy costs could negatively influence economic growth and decrease consumer spending. Investors should closely monitor the financial sector for possible volatility as these developments unfold.

Jamie Dimon JPMorgan shareholder letter warns of 2026 risks
bearishApr 6, 2026 · 12:40 PM

Jamie Dimon JPMorgan shareholder letter warns of 2026 risks

In his latest shareholder letter, JPMorgan CEO Jamie Dimon outlines potential risks facing the financial markets by 2026, citing economic concerns such as inflation and geopolitical tensions. Dimon's warnings highlight the challenges that could impact the financial sector and the broader economy. He emphasizes the importance of preparedness for potential downturns, which could lead to increased volatility in bank stocks. This cautious outlook may create a bearish sentiment among investors in the banking sector. Overall, while JPMorgan remains a strong player, the caution shared by Dimon suggests that investors should be vigilant moving forward.
